Gentoo Archives: gentoo-user

From: Nick Khamis <symack@×××××.com>
To: gentoo-user@l.g.o
Subject: Re: [gentoo-user] Updating our live servers. I'm scared!
Date: Thu, 28 Mar 2013 18:10:37
Message-Id: CAGWRaZaPQ+bXFTE6-JJ53555B-X4y6pt_4SH72=wE+_iD61L3g@mail.gmail.com
In Reply to: Re: [gentoo-user] Updating our live servers. I'm scared! by Nick Khamis
1 As mentioned earlier a temporary change of profile got me on my way
2
3 eselect profile set 0
4 env-update
5 eselect profile set 7
6
7 Moving forward... Thanks guys.
8
9 On 3/28/13, Nick Khamis <symack@×××××.com> wrote:
10 > But we never changed our profile? Always running hardened server.
11 >
12 > N.
13 >
14 > On 3/28/13, Nick Khamis <symack@×××××.com> wrote:
15 >> I switched to the default profile from hardened:
16 >>
17 >> eselect profile list
18 >> Available profile symlink targets:
19 >> [1] default/linux/x86/13.0 *
20 >>
21 >> env-update
22 >> !!! Unable to parse profile: '/etc/portage/make.profile'
23 >> !!! ParseError: Profile contains unsupported EAPI '5':
24 >> '/usr/portage/profiles/default/linux/x86/13.0/eapi'
25 >>>>> Regenerating /etc/ld.so.cache...
26 >>
27 >> And still can't update portage.
28 >>
29 >> N.
30 >>
31 >> On 3/28/13, Michael Orlitzky <michael@××××××××.com> wrote:
32 >>> On 03/28/2013 01:43 PM, Nick Khamis wrote:
33 >>>> First hickup
34 >>>>
35 >>>> emerge -puDN1 world
36 >>>> !!! Unable to parse profile: '/etc/portage/make.profile'
37 >>>> !!! ParseError: Profile contains unsupported EAPI '5':
38 >>>> '/usr/portage/profiles/eapi-5-files/eapi'
39 >>>> !!! Your current profile is invalid. If you have just changed your
40 >>>> profile
41 >>>> !!! configuration, you should revert back to the previous
42 >>>> configuration.
43 >>>> !!! Allowed actions are limited to --help, --info, --search, --sync,
44 >>>> and
45 >>>>
46 >>>>
47 >>>> We were always running hardened. Never changed the profile.
48 >>>>
49 >>>
50 >>> Hmm.. this is probably /someone's/ bug. Nevertheless, all you have to do
51 >>> to fix it us update portage to the current stable version, which
52 >>> supports EAPI5. Can you switch to another profile temporarily and get
53 >>> portage updated?
54 >>>
55 >>>
56 >>>
57 >>
58 >